Subject: Handing off zero-downtime migrations

Hi,

Quick heads-up before the next release train: I'm stepping back from owning the schema migration tooling on Drovewell. The expand-contract playbook, the Shimgate dual-write helper, and the rollback checklist all transfer with the role. Nothing changes process-wise — migrations still need a green dry-run in staging before you cut a release. Going forward, route all migration approvals and questions to the new owner named below.

account owner for bawip-tahag: Raleth Quenok

**CI note: Relevance tuning suite flaking on Brightmere search**

The nightly relevance regression job for Brightmere intermittently fails on synonym-expansion cases, not due to ranking changes but because the tuning-notes fixture loads before the analyzer warms up. Re-running the stage usually passes. Please hold the release train until two consecutive green runs, and record the passing build, noted below.

build token for kagaf-hahof: htk14_9d3d4d26d7d8de

Leadership Review Briefing — Project Arden Delay

For the board: Project Ardenlight, the internal tooling migration, is now four months behind its original schedule. Root causes are a mid-stream vendor change and underestimated data-cleansing effort. Spend to date is within 8% of budget; the revised go-live is set for the second quarter. Marta Keel has assumed delivery ownership and reports fortnightly. No customer-facing impact is expected. The wider implications for next year's plan are set out below.

internal memo for yahag-hahig: Belwynix Group plans to lower the Silir list price by 62 percent in May.

The 2024 color-contrast audit of the Glimmerpane UI covered all primary flows and flagged 41 components below the 4.5:1 threshold, mostly in the muted-text and disabled-state palettes. Fixes shipped in releases 3.2 through 3.5; the remaining exceptions are documented with rationale and sign-off. Maintainers adding new components should use the approved token palette rather than raw hex values, since the tokens were adjusted during remediation. The full audit report, methodology, and the exception register are kept on the internal page below.

runbook for badug-kadup: https://confluence.zemvarlabs.internal/projects/browse/display/projects/bd1b